Functionality: The 2N7002KDWA-TP is designed to switch electronic signals on or off. Being an N-channel MOSFET, it is "on" (conducting) when a positive voltage is applied to its gate (relative to its source), and "off" (non-conducting) otherwise.
Application Scenarios:
1. Power management in portable devices.
2. Switching loads, such as small motors or light bulbs.
3. Digital logic circuits as a switching element.
4. Signal routing.
5. Conversion circuits like boost or buck converters.
Key Parameters:
1. Drain-Source Voltage (Vds) - The maximum voltage difference the transistor can handle between its drain and source.
2. The range of voltages in which a transistor can function is known as the gate-source voltage (Vgs).
3. Continuous Drain Current (Id) - The maximum current it can handle in the on state.
4. Threshold Voltage (Vth) - The voltage at which the transistor starts to turn on.
Sample Application: Switching a Load
1. Overview:
We will consider using the 2N7002KDWA-TP to switch a small DC motor on and off using a microcontroller.
2. Circuit Setup:
- MOSFET Gate: Connect the gate of the 2N7002KDWA-TP to a digital output pin of the microcontroller.
- MOSFET Drain: Connect the drain of the 2N7002KDWA-TP to one terminal of the DC motor.
- MOSFET Source: Connect the source of the 2N7002KDWA-TP to the ground (common ground with the microcontroller).
- Motor Terminal: Connect the DC motor's other end to the power supply's positive terminal.
3. Circuit design considerations include:
- Gate Drive Voltage: Ensure the microcontroller output pin can provide a voltage high enough to fully turn on the 2N7002KDWA-TP.
- Protection: Include a diode in parallel with the motor to protect the 2N7002KDWA-TP from voltage spikes that can occur when the motor turns off (known as flyback voltage).
- Heat Dissipation: If the motor draws significant current, ensure that the 2N7002KDWA-TP can dissipate the heat generated. A heatsink may be required.
- Gate Pull-down Resistor: Connect a resistor (e.g., 10kΩ) from the gate of the 2N7002KDWA-TP to the ground. This ensures that the MOSFET remains off when the microcontroller output is floating (e.g., during startup).
Using the 2N7002KDWA-TP in this application allows for precise control of the motor via the microcontroller, enabling tasks like speed modulation or timed operations.
Note: Always refer to the datasheet of the 2N7002KDWA-TP to understand its detailed specifications and limitations when designing circuits.
